Hollywood System
The traditional practices, structures, and methods of the major film studios in Hollywood, focusing on the star system and genre films.
Nonlinear Flashback
A narrative technique used in storytelling where the chronological sequence of events is disrupted, often through the insertion of memories or past events at points in the story where they provide context or emotional depth.
Narrative Structure
The organizational framework of a story, outlining the way in which its plot is constructed, including the exposition, rising action, climax, falling action, and resolution.
Wartime Filmmaking
The production of movies during periods of war, often characterized by themes of patriotism, propaganda, and the depiction of heroism and sacrifice.
